A right-handed pitcher who redshirted in 2005, after joining the team in January, and missed the majority of last season after having right knee surgery...did record two strikeouts in an inning at UC Santa Barbara Feb. 25...both pitched and played shortstop in high school...throws in the mid to high 80s with a curveball, slider and change-up...
HIGH SCHOOL/PERSONAL: At Woodside High School was a three-time all-league selection and a two-way (pitcher, shortstop) all-league pick as a senior, batting .389 with an ERA under 2.00...was selected to the inaugural BC Bay Area World Series as both a pitcher and shortstop...helped his high school team to league titles in 2001 and 2003...played for 18U All-Star Academy Showcase team in 2003, batting .391...played for the AAU West Bay Titans team that placed seventh at both the 2001 (Sarasota, Fla.) and 2003 (Ann Arbor, Mich.) national tournaments...while in high school, also competed in rugby for the Palo Alto Green Beavers Football Club...in the summer of 2006 played for the Hawaii Alii's in the Hawaii Collegiate League with Cal teammate Dane Ferguson...majoring in American studies...parents are Guy and Christine De La Rosa...born September 18, 1986 in Stanford, Calif.
